题解 | #信号顺序调整#

信号顺序调整

https://www.nowcoder.com/practice/3f6db9ded7ca4de7981c0a826e924563

`timescale 1ns/1ns

module top_module(
    input [15:0] in,
    output [15:0] out
);
    wire[3:0]  a,b,c,d;//这个数据类型和C是一样理解的,位宽也是数据类型
    //用拼接
    assign {a,b,c,d} = in;
    assign out = {d,c,b,a};
endmodule
//16 in
//and [3:0] -- 4 * 4 = 16
//4 * (i+1) - 1 * 4(i)

全部评论

相关推荐

评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客企业服务